rOACCT/node_modules/istanbul-lib-report2e74391c0d8edev
rOACCT/node_modules/istanbul-lib-report
2e74391c0d8edev
istanbul-lib-report
istanbul-lib-report
README.md
README.md
istanbul-lib-report
data:image/s3,"s3://crabby-images/cf129/cf129ee08acc847b1870890432713dc34060805b" alt="Greenkeeper badge" data:image/s3,"s3://crabby-images/655e2/655e21999acec3ce2f786976fd3c0261a0b1bd04" alt="Build Status"
Core reporting utilities for istanbul.
Example usage
js const libReport = require('istanbul-lib-report'); const reports = require('istanbul-reports'); // coverageMap, for instance, obtained from istanbul-lib-coverage const coverageMap; const configWatermarks = { statements: [50, 80], functions: [50, 80], branches: [50, 80], lines: [50, 80] }; // create a context for report generation const context = libReport.createContext({ dir: 'report/output/dir', // The summarizer to default to (may be overridden by some reports) // values can be nested/flat/pkg. Defaults to 'pkg' defaultSummarizer: 'nested', watermarks: configWatermarks, coverageMap, }) // create an instance of the relevant report class, passing the // report name e.g. json/html/html-spa/text const report = reports.create('json', { skipEmpty: configSkipEmpty, skipFull: configSkipFull }) // call execute to synchronously create and write the report to disk report.execute(context)
c4science · Help